Output 6e1b73685691b652a433185b42d9e1490daeab865f2a62fed161e63df5ce9ec7:39

value
19278362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e72cf482a76eef53db40a34a183e54715129c6 OP_EQUAL
address
MWbEkNEFVijNFD62Kzt3EiQ6d7VsTBP7ks
transaction
6e1b73685691b652a433185b42d9e1490daeab865f2a62fed161e63df5ce9ec7
spent
true